Job Search and Career Advice Platform

¡Activa las notificaciones laborales por email!

Brand Manager - INT003

GigaBrands

A distancia

MXN 900,000 - 1,261,000

Jornada completa

Ayer
Sé de los primeros/as/es en solicitar esta vacante

Genera un currículum adaptado en cuestión de minutos

Consigue la entrevista y gana más. Más información

Descripción de la vacante

A fast-growing marketing agency in Mexico City is seeking a Brand Manager to manage client accounts and drive growth across Amazon brands. The successful candidate will collaborate with internal teams to execute strategies and enhance client satisfaction. This role offers full-time remote work aligned with US hours, a defined career path towards leadership positions, and access to continuous learning opportunities within a values-driven culture.

Servicios

Opportunity to impact client growth
Structured career path towards leadership
Access to upskilling sessions
Collaborative culture

Formación

  • 5+ years of experience in account management, brand management, or eCommerce leadership roles.
  • Proven experience managing client relationships and delivering measurable results.
  • Strong leadership skills, with prior experience managing teams across different functions.

Responsabilidades

  • Manage day-to-day client accounts and strategies that drive sales.
  • Collaborate with internal teams across PPC, SEO, design, and catalog management.
  • Act as a trusted partner to clients balancing relationship management and operational execution.

Conocimientos

Account management
Brand management
eCommerce leadership
Client relationship management
Strong leadership skills
Knowledge of Amazon operations
Excellent organizational skills
Strong communication skills
Task management
Familiarity with project management platforms
Descripción del empleo

The Brand Manager is a key member of the client success and operations team at GIGABRANDS. Sitting between the Brand Director and Junior Brand Managers, this role is responsible for managing day-to-day client accounts, strategies that drive sales, and ensuring exceptional service delivery across multiple Amazon brands.

As a Brand Manager, you’ll work closely with internal teams across PPC, SEO, design, and catalog management to bring client strategies to life. You’ll act as a trusted partner to clients—balancing relationship management, operational execution, and performance optimization.

You’ll also participate in “husks”—our internal team-building and development sessions—where you’ll collaborate with peers, learn from senior leaders, and help foster a culture of continuous growth and learning. Senior Brand Managers also take part in weekly upskilling classes to mentor and support the broader team.

Qualifications
  • 5+ years of experience in account management, brand management, or eCommerce leadership roles
  • Proven experience managing client relationships and delivering measurable results
  • Strong leadership skills, with prior experience managing teams across different functions and geographies
  • Knowledge of Amazon operations (PPC, SEO, catalog, design, merchandising)
  • Excellent organizational skills with attention to detail (task management, reporting, workflow)
  • Strong communication and presentation skills with clients and internal teams
  • Ability to thrive in a fast-paced, entrepreneurial, and client-facing environment
  • Familiarity with project/task management platforms (e.g., ClickUp)
Benefits
  • Full-time, remote position aligned with US working hours.
  • Opportunity to directly impact client growth and brand success.
  • Structured career path toward Brand Director and leadership roles.
  • Participation in internal husks and access to weekly upskilling sessions.
  • Collaborative, values-driven culture built on trust, learning, and performance.
  • Be part of a fast-growing agency making waves in the Amazon ecosystem.
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.